Analisis Kesalahan Siswa SMP dalam Menyelesaikan Tes Literasi Statistik Berdasarkan Tahapan Kastolan

Abstract: Statistika merupakan bagian penting dari kurikulum matematika sekolah dan berperan penting dalam berbagai aktivitas manusia di era globalisasi. Oleh karena itu, semua siswa harus mempelajari statistika sebagai bagian dari pendidikannya. Salah satu tujuan penting pendidikan statistika di sekolah adalah literasi statistik. Namun, pentingnya literasi statistik sebagai kemampuan yang harus dimiliki siswa tidak sesuai kenyataan di lapangan.
